Cis desensitizes GH induced Stat5 signaling in rat liver cells

H Karlsson1, J A Gustafsson, A Mode

  • 1Department of Medical Nutrition, Karolinska Institutet, Novum, Huddinge, Sweden. hanna.karlsson@mednut.ki.se

Insights

Growth hormone (GH) induces Cis mRNA in rat liver cells, a key step in regulating Jak/Stat signaling. Cis protein plays a role in the sexually dimorphic GH signaling observed in rats.

Background:

  • The Cis/Socs protein family acts as negative regulators of cytokine-induced Janus kinase/Signal transducer and activator of transcription (Jak/Stat) signaling pathways.
  • Growth hormone (GH) signaling is crucial in various physiological processes and exhibits sex-specific patterns in rats.

Purpose of the Study:

  • To investigate the role of Cis and Socs-2 proteins in growth hormone (GH)-mediated Jak/Stat signaling in rat liver.
  • To explore the potential involvement of Cis in the sexually dimorphic regulation of GH signaling.

Main Methods:

  • Quantitative analysis of Socs-2 and Cis mRNA expression in rat liver under GH influence.
  • In vitro studies using primary rat hepatocytes to assess GH-induced Cis mRNA expression.
  • Cotransfection experiments in the BRL-4 rat liver cell line to evaluate the functional impact of Cis and Socs-2 on GH-activated Stat5 signaling.

Main Results:

  • Socs-2 and Cis mRNA expression in rat liver is dependent on the presence of GH.
  • GH was found to induce Cis mRNA expression in primary rat hepatocytes.
  • Constitutive expression of Cis, but not Socs-2, significantly inhibited GH-induced transactivation of a Stat5-responsive reporter gene in BRL-4 cells.

Conclusions:

  • Cis plays a functional role in the desensitization of GH-activated Jak/Stat5 signaling in rat liver cells.
  • GH induction of Cis is a potential mechanism contributing to the sexually dimorphic GH signaling via Stat5b in the rat liver, influenced by secretion patterns.
